Summary
This study aims to pilot the Care for Child Development (CCD) Program, developed by UNICEF, for use it our population in Kenya. It has been found to improve developmental outcomes at 12 months and 24 months of age in Pakistan. As is the pilot nature of this study, a major focus of our study is to determine if the intervention ad study methodology is feasible and acceptable. We will also collect preliminary data to see if this intervention is effective in our population.
